Two way coupling means the particle momentum/temperature is seen by the flow field. Otherwise the trajectories are governed by the flow but the flow isn't affected by the particles. Particle-particle is four way coupling.Â
Wall rebound tends to be set in the wall boundary condition, under DPM.Â
